The boys fought as hard as counselors running for safety in the woods! With two minutes to go in the game, the Owls converted yes, believe it or not, a fourth and 13, YES, I SAID 13! Hondo ended up scoring giving the Pirates one last ditch effort.
These boys drove down the field to the Owls 13-yard line, YES, I SAID 13-yard line. With an unfortunate penalty, we had to run 10 seconds of the clock and ended up falling short in the end, with Hondo winning 28-22. Hard running by AJ Cantu and Angel De La Rosa, along with good Offensive and Defensive line play, gave us a chance in the end. The boys are 2-2 and are looking forward to playing in Cotulla next week. Thanks again to our awesome cheerleaders and cheer sponsors!
